Childhood and youth

Andrei Pavlovich was born early in the fall of 1930 in Leningrad in an intelligent family. Father Pavel Platonovich was a surgeon, Olga Petrovna's mother - an artist.

During the war, Andrei was evacuated to the Siberian town of Leninsk-Kuznetsky, where the Leningrad Conservatory was taken out. The abundance of classical musicians led to the opening in the city of the first music school, in which Petrov studied to play violin. The teenager was not going to associate life with music - created stories and illustrations to them.

The decision to become the composer came to Andrey after viewing the picture "Big Waltz" - Johanna Straussa Bayopic. Congenital abilities of Petrov secured training at the conservatory.

Music

Andrei Pavlovich is a very prolific composer, the Peru belongs to the operas, ballets, symphonies, romances and instrumental concerts. The most famous from the "Ninexiatographic" Heritage of Petrova Ballet "Creation of the World" and the Opera "Peter First", at the premiere of which the curiosity occurred. The author of the work, exhausted with rehearsals, fell asleep on the first execution, sitting in the first row of the parquet.

However, it is known to each Soviet man Petrov, thanks to the music for the films. Andrei Pavlovich's debut in the cinema (music to the Music-Amphibian tape of the director of Vladimir Chebotarev and Gennady Kazan) became a triumphal. After a quarter of a century, the composer and the director again worked together over the film "Battalions are asking for fire."

Stanislav Rostotsky collaborated with Petrov ("White Bim Black Ear"), Georgy Delialia ("I'm walking in Moscow", "Autumn Marathon") and such a nemeinstream director, as Alexey Herman ("Khrustalev, Machine!").

Andrei Pavlovich for Eldar Ryazanov became a genuine co-author and talisman of good luck. Without melodies, Petrova it is impossible to submit the Ryazan "Garage" and "Beware of the car", "Service Roman" and "Sleep the word about the poor hussar".

Personal life

The personal life of Andrei Petrova did not have anything in common with passions and scandals, which were filled with the biographies of colleagues of the composer. For more than half a century, the musician lived in a happy marriage with a journalist Natalie Efimovna. In 1956, his wife gave Andrei Pavlovich the only daughter called in honor of the composer's mother. Olga Andreevna went at the footsteps of the Father, the music for the TV series "Petersburg secrets" Petrov wrote together.

Death

Andrei Pavlovich died suddenly in February 2006. The cause of death is stroke. 6 months before the death, the composer wrote a work "Farewell to ...". When the journalists asked the musician to explain the name, Petrov replied that the person throughout his life constantly had to say goodbye - with former passions and hobbies, with people whom he never sees.

The composer is buried on the second in the prestigiousness of St. Petersburg - "Literal Mostkits" of the Volkovsky cemetery. The tombstone on the grave was performed by architect Vyacheslav Bukhaev, co-author of Chizhik-poultry on the fountain. The opening of the monument to Andrei Pavlovich took place on the birthday of the musician - September 2, 2007. On the same day, the first All-Russian composer competition was started, which since then takes place annually in St. Petersburg.

The memory of the author of melodic music is immortalized in the title of theatrical and concert hall of the Humanitarian University of Trade Unions, with whom a man collaborated. The name Andrei Petrov is named the garden, which arose in the Petrograd side on the site of the nameless Square, and a small planet.
